Nationally well-known smoothie chain Jamba has landed in Delaware County.

The first Jamba in central Ohio opened earlier in September at Polaris Fashion Place Mall (upper level near the main entrance). Try plant-based smoothies, delicious bowls with fresh fruit toppings, protein-packed food, and on-the-go snacks.

Jamba has over 700 locations, with four others in Ohio – two in Toledo, and one each in Bowling Green and Youngstown.

Jamba was established as Jamba Juice 32 years ago in San Luis Obispo, California. Today, the concept is owned by Focus Brands. Focus is the home of brands Cinnabon, Auntie Anne’s, Carvel, and Scholtzky’s.

In August 2020, the first international Jamba opened in Tokyo. Southeast Asia remains the chain’s strongest overseas market.
